Embark on an easy road cycling adventure with the Muir of Ord loop from Inverness, a route designed for racebikes that takes you through the scenic Scottish Highlands. This 26.8-mile (43.1 km) journey, with a manageable 753 feet (229 metres) of elevation gain, offers picturesque coastal views along the Beauly Firth and winds through rich farmland and ancient woodlands. You can expect to complete this ride in about 1 hour and 51 minutes, enjoying mostly well-paved surfaces as you cycle.
Starting from Inverness, the route is easily accessible and provides a convenient way to explore the region. The Kessock Bridge, a notable landmark, features a dedicated cycle path, making for a safe and enjoyable crossing with panoramic views. While the primary surfaces are asphalt and paved roads, be aware that some segments might include compacted gravel. You will find amenities like bike-friendly cafes in Muir of Ord, such as Café Artisans at the Muir Hub, perfect for a break.
This loop is celebrated for its blend of natural beauty and historical significance, making it a rewarding experience for various fitness levels. As you ride, you will pass by significant historical sites like the ruins of Beauly Priory, a 13th-century landmark, and Redcastle Ruins. The route also traverses river valleys, including the Beauly and Conon rivers, and offers glimpses of moorland, showcasing the diverse landscapes of the Highlands. The Glen Ord Distillery in Muir of Ord also presents an interesting stop if you have extra time.
